Abstract
The paper describes the design and implementation of a heuristic fuzzy controller for traffic management in urban areas. The controller uses expert knowledge for the derivation of its fuzzy rules. The proposed controller is simulated and compared to a conventional proportional controller by means of the software platform for traffic management AIMSUN.
